RESPONSIBILITIES
Develop new business relationships by personally presenting to major accounts within assigned region.
Develop and maintain sales by exploring and qualifying existing accounts
Instruct and train Territory Sales Managers in the selling of products and services.
Lead and coach a team of sales, manufacturing reps.
Maintain up to date records on all major accounts including sales data, quote records, and customer contacts.
Provide accurate feedback to management on missed quotes and future trends.
Coordinate activities with Inside Sales Teams to maximize our ability to close on new business opportunities.
Provide assurance to management that all policies are carried out accurately.
Consult with management in formulating a sales and marketing strategy.
Define product(s) with customers.
Prepare comprehensive quote packages for customers.
Prepare technical sales presentation in MS PowerPoint.
Monitor timing, development and manufacturing of products/programs.
Monitor cost changes/cost reduction measures/annual reductions, and ensure sales prices amended timely.
Visit customer base frequently, identify programs and program specifics.
Support development teams in gaining product specific information from customer and required third parties.
Support license partners, suppliers and trace production record.
Adheres to quality and safety systems or maintenance of quality and safety standards.
REQUIREMENTS
Knowledge of principles and methods for showing, promoting, and selling products or services.
Knowledge of business and management principles involved in strategic planning, resource allocation, human resources modeling, leadership technique, production methods, and coordination of people and resources.
Knowledge of the business behavior, customs, tradition, in automotive and Consumer Electronics industry
Working experiences in Automotive industry, Consumer Electronics industry, OEM or Parts manufacturer
Data driven
Knowledge of principles and processes for providing customer and personal services. This includes customer needs assessment, meeting quality standards for services, and evaluation of customer satisfaction.
EDUCATION / EXPERIENCE
Minimum 7 years of combined experience in sales in the electronics industry.
Minimum of 7 years experience as a Territory Sales Manager calling on major OEM accounts.
Minimum 7 years of experience as a people leader
Bachelor degree in (Electronic Engineering) or Bachelor degree in Economics plus work-related skill, knowledge, or experience in automotive reception systems.
